Actual Size.
GOLD COLLAR,
Weight, 1 oz. 13 dwts.
Found July 1856,
In draining a Field near Baileyborough, Co. Cavan, Ireland.

Actual Size.
ANCIENT GOLD TORQUE,
Weight, 37 dwts. 6 grs.
Found near Mangerton, County Kerry, 1842,
8 Feet below th surface of the Bog.
